Output 758225c3975424de95e286e120a40ecb17f52af507c5110f68c63263a04369fe:0

value
714000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b78371f2c15e707b29586b80c9b59952bb993f1c OP_EQUAL
address
3JRM3cdTe7nje8WwLemjLWJAh4fZCSKhfq
transaction
758225c3975424de95e286e120a40ecb17f52af507c5110f68c63263a04369fe